Aide pour un convertisseur buck

Portrait de Sierra Nevada

Bonjour tout le monde,

Je travaille actuellement sur un convertisseur buck (ci-joints les détails).

J'utilise un driver mosfet IR2104 pour commander les deux Mosfets 1 et 2 (avec arduino).

ça a l'air de bien marcher pour charger une batterie de 12V ou en alimentant une charge de 12V.

Puis après, j'ai décidé de créer des borniers spécialement pour batterie et pour la charge, çàd que j'alimente en même temps la batterie et la charge à l'aide d'un PV par l'intermédiaire de ce convertisseur buck.

Pour se faire, j'ai mis un troisième Mosfet (commander directement par arduino) pour connecter/deconnecter la charge selon le niveau de la tension de batterie.

Dès que je mets en marche ledit convertisseur, les pins (6) VS, (7) HO et (8) VB du driver mosfet IR2104 sont grillés et le Mosfet1 se met à chauffer.

Est-ce que vous pouvez m'aider à expliquer ce phénomène et de proposer une piste de solution pour ce petit projet?

Portrait de hercule124

Bonjour, le drain et la source sont inversés sur le mosfet1

Portrait de Sierra Nevada

Merci pour ta réponse, j'ai refais le schéma!